Understanding Identity and Access Management (IAM) Systems

In today’s digital world, security is a major concern for organizations, and one of the key aspects of ensuring strong security is managing user identities and their access to sensitive data. This is where Identity and Access Management (IAM) comes into play. IAM refers to the policies, tools, and technologies used to manage and secure digital identities, ensuring that only authorized individuals can access specific resources.

What is Identity and Access Management (IAM)?
At its core, IAM is a framework that ensures the right individuals (or machines) can access the right resources at the right times, for the right reasons. It’s not just about identifying users, but also managing what they can and cannot do once their identity has been authenticated. This includes controlling access to networks, systems, applications, and databases based on predefined security policies.

IAM solutions typically involve tools that authenticate users, authorize them to access specific resources, and continuously monitor their access and activities. The goal is to protect sensitive data, minimize security breaches, and streamline the user experience.

Key Components of IAM
Authentication: It can be done through various means, such as usernames and passwords, biometrics (fingerprints, facial recognition), or two-factor authentication (2FA), where users provide two forms of verification.

Authorization: After authentication, the system determines what level of access the user is granted. This is based on their roles, responsibilities, or other attributes. For instance, an employee might have access to certain internal systems but not to others containing highly sensitive information.

User Provisioning and De-provisioning: When new users join an organization or a system, they need to be granted access. Similarly, when they leave, access must be promptly revoked. IAM automates this process to ensure users are granted the appropriate access rights from day one and deactivated immediately when necessary.

Access Control Policies: IAM systems enforce rules that govern who can access what resources and under what conditions. This is often done through role-based access control (RBAC), where users are assigned roles based on their job responsibilities. The system then determines what resources the user can access based on these roles.

Monitoring and Auditing: Continuous monitoring of access activity helps identify any unusual or unauthorized behavior. IAM systems also provide audit trails, which are essential for compliance and security. This feature helps organizations track who accessed specific data and when.

Benefits of IAM
Enhanced Security: By ensuring that only authenticated and authorized users can access specific data and resources, IAM solutions reduce the risk of data breaches and insider threats. Implementing multi-factor authentication (MFA) and strong password policies adds an extra layer of security.

Compliance: Many industries are subject to strict regulatory requirements, such as HIPAA, GDPR, or PCI-DSS, that mandate the protection of personal or sensitive data. IAM systems make it easier for organizations to comply with these regulations by providing centralized control over access and ensuring proper auditing.

Improved User Experience: IAM streamlines the user login process by enabling features like single sign-on (SSO), where users can access multiple applications with one set of credentials. This not only enhances convenience but also reduces the likelihood of password fatigue or poor password management.

Operational Efficiency: With automated user provisioning and de-provisioning, IAM systems help businesses save time and resources. This automation ensures that employees are granted access to necessary tools without delay and can easily be revoked from systems when they leave the organization.
